Only 2 Weeks Left in the WAVE Sampling Season

There are only two weeks left to collect your 2015 WAVE samples; the sampling season ends September 30. Now is the time, my friends. The heat has passed and the leaves are changing. It’s a beautiful time to be out in NY streams!

You’ll have until November 1st to submit your voucher collections and data sheets. The simplest way to do so is to mail them to me (see address below) using the USPS packaging instructions for small volume flammable liquids (http://pe.usps.com/text/Pub52/pub52apxc_010.htm). If you prefer to drop these off at a NYSDEC regional office, please notify me in advance so that I can reach out to staff at that office and confirm that they can receive the samples.

I’ve already received and processed several samples. I am emailing the sample results to the collectors as soon as I process them. **NEW** this year, I am also continuously updating a Google map with all the sample results: https://goo.gl/3MBxAm

Also **NEW** this year, I am actively requesting and recording your perspective. Many WAVErs have specific concerns which they are trying to tackle. Others are simply enjoying the process and taking lots of photos. Whatever your perspective, I want to give you the opportunity to share your experience. Feel free to write a summary, send along photographs, or provide a report or summary you've written for another purpose. I am uploading these documents to the google map linked above.
